This book is a fascinating and engaging examination of the Bastille, the infamous prison that held many political prisoners during the French Revolution. Funckbrentano and Maidment cover the history of the Bastille, as well as the legends and myths that have arisen around it. This book is a must-read for anyone interested in the history of the French Revolution and its impact on French society.This work has been selected by scholars as being culturally important, and is part of the knowledge base of civilization as we know it.This work is in the "public domain in the United States of America, and possibly other nations.
